  • School Accreditation: SACS COC, + 3 more
  • Programmatic Accreditation: ACEN, + 3 more
  • Student Population: 23,480 (12:1 student-to-faculty)
  • Undergraduate Tuition: $18,484
  • Graduate Tuition: $13,625
  • Recommendation Rate: 50%
